Material Recycling in Transport
Recycling means re-introducing waste material into the production process, as addition to primary resources. The use of waste as secondary raw material is economically justified. By using old material not only primary raw material is saved, but energy as well. The paper presents the most frequent materials, the ways in which they are collected, and subsequent classification. The sorting procedures have been mentioned, with throughput capacity an important parameter expressed in tonnes per hour. The higher the throughput capacity, the better the effect of sorting.
